The right choice is the one that you think is best. Everything has risks. For me, I really didn't want my insides re-routed or taken out, ala bypass and gastric sleeve. The band is not easy, it takes WORK- you have to commit, follow the rules (eating small bites slowly, not drinking with meals or after, eating solid Protein, not "eating around the band" with unhealthy junk). You have to exercise (most people do). You have to watch what you put in your mouth.

Good luck in your decision. I am so happy I did it, I've lost over 70 lbs in 6 months.
